Frederick Jackson Turner was known for the “frontier thesis.”

Frederick stated  that Europeans' transformation began with the process of settling the American continent and considered  "frontier history" as something  unique about the United States.

He referred to the frontier as a place of opportunity that will help to defuse social discontent in America.

"So long as free land exists, the opportunity for a competency exists, and economic power secures political power."
